What Are the 2025 Kona Electric Trims & Features?

Hyundai introduces the Kona Electric in four thoughtfully designed trims: SE, SEL, N Line, and Limited. The SE trim, at the entry-level, is packed with essential features, making it a compelling option. Noteworthy features include a 12.3-inch touchscreen equipped with navigation, a fully digital gauge cluster, wireless support for Apple CarPlay/Android Auto, and dual-zone automatic climate control.

The SEL trim enhances the experience with an improved set of features. It includes a power driver's seat with lumbar support for increased comfort and roof side rails to help secure additional cargo. Heated front seats also come standard with this trim.

The new N Line trim of the Kona Electric offers a more assertive look. Enthusiasts will enjoy the Bose premium audio system and striking details like black Alcantara Sport seating surfaces, metal sport pedals, and wireless device charging.

The luxurious Limited trim is at the top of the lineup. Its ventilated front seats keep you cool on sweltering days, while a hands-free smart liftgate simplifies loading cargo. This top trim also features Remote Smart Parking Assist to help you easily navigate crowded areas.

How Much Horsepower Does It Have?

The all-electric powertrain produces a satisfying 201 horsepower, enabling smooth and effortless acceleration. With Drive Mode Select, you can choose among four modes: Eco, Normal, Sport, and Snow. Hyundai has provided the Kona Electric with a multi-link rear suspension to optimize handling and ride comfort. Moreover, this crossover is noted for its remarkable driving range.

What Safety Features Does the 2025 Kona Electric Include?

When driving the new Kona Electric, you can depend on its suite of SmartSense safety features to bolster your confidence. For example, Hyundai's Forward Collision-Avoidance Assist System is capable of intervening even when making a left turn to help avert an accident. Additional standard safety features include Navigation-based Smart Cruise Control with Stop & Go, Lane Keeping Assist, and Blind-Spot Collision Warning.
